#SQL MANAGEMENT STUDIO SHOULD BE INSTALLED FROM WHERE YOU RUN THIS
#The server this is run from should have SQL Port and WMI access to the servers you intend to connect to.
#You will require file sqlserver.psd1, change the path to it below.
Import-Module -Name D:\PATH\TO\sqlserver.psd1 -DisableNameChecking
#Load SQL Management Studio Assembly
[System.Reflection.Assembly]::LoadWithPartialName('Microsoft.SqlServer.SMO')
$ErrorActionPreference = "SilentlyContinue"
$domain = 'DOMAIN'
#SA Windows User Account
$user = "$domain\USERNAME"
$sql_perm_data = @()
$userrole = @()
$date = get-date -format MM-dd
$day = get-date -format dd
$month = get-date -format MM
$year = get-date -format yy
$HKLM = 2147483650
$SQLEdition = "Enterprise"
$SQLPort = "1433"
#List of servers IP's
$IPs = Import-CSV D:\PATH\TO\CSVFILE.CSV
#If you are writing this to a SQL server provide that info below.
$storeSQLserver = "SQL_SERVER"
$storeSQLDatabase = "DATABASE"
$storeTable = "TABLE"
#Get user credentials as wmi, password as encrypted text file, change to your encrypted password location.
$wmiCredentials = New-Object System.Management.Automation.PsCredential $user, (Get-Content D:\YOUR\ENC\PASSWORD.ENC | ConvertTo-SecureString)
#Uncomment to enter credentials on demand
#$wmiCredentials = Get-Credential -credential $null
#Intended to only run once per day, so we begin by erasing todays data if it already exists, so we don't end up with duplicate data.
$query = "DELETE FROM $storeTable where DATE LIKE '$date%' AND DOMAIN LIKE '$domain%'";
Invoke-Sqlcmd -ServerInstance $storeSQLServer -Database $storeSQLdatabase-Query $query -MaxCharLength 3000 -Verbose
foreach ($IP in $IPs) {
clear-variable srv -ErrorAction SilentlyContinue
$IP = $IP.IP.replace("`n", "") | out-string
$IP = $IP.replace(" ", "") | out-string
$IP = $IP.trim()
#Get the name of the server
$sysinfo = Get-WmiObject -computer $IP -credential $wmiCredentials -Class Win32_ComputerSystem -ErrorAction SilentlyContinue
$server = $sysinfo.Name
$portCheck = Test-NetConnection -computername $IP -port $SQLPort
if ($portCheck.tcpTestSucceeded -like "True") { $portPassed = "True" }else { write-host "Unable to Connect to $IP on $SQLPort" }
if ($portPassed -like "True") {
write-host "Connecting to $server..."
clear-variable listenername -ErrorAction SilentlyContinue
clear-variable srv -ErrorAction SilentlyContinue
clear-variable instance -ErrorAction SilentlyContinue
write-host "Checking registry for HA $server..."
$reg = Get-WmiObject -List -Namespace root\default -computername $IP -Credential $wmiCredentials | Where-Object { $_.Name -eq "StdRegProv" }
#Collecting SQL cluster availibility group information
#Availibilty Group Name
$agName = $reg.EnumValues($HKLM, "Cluster\HadrAgNameToIdMap").sNames
#Cluster Name
$clusterName = $reg.getStringValue($HKLM, "Cluster", "ClusterName").sValue
#Listerner Name
$GUID = $reg.EnumKey($HKLM, "Cluster\Resources").sNames | `
where-object { $reg.getStringValue($HKLM, "Cluster\Resources\$_\Parameters", "DnsName").sValue -notlike $NULL`
-and $reg.getStringValue($HKLM, "Cluster\Resources\$_\Parameters", "DnsName").sValue -notlike "*$clusterName*"
}
$listenerName = $reg.getStringValue($HKLM, "Cluster\Resources\$GUID\Parameters", "DnsName").sValue
#Get SQL Instances
write-host "Getting SQL instances $server..."
$reg = Get-WmiObject -List -Namespace root\default -ComputerName $IP -Credential $wmiCredentials | Where-Object { $_.Name -eq "StdRegProv" }
$regkeys = $reg.GetMultiStringValue($HKLM, "SOFTWARE\Microsoft\Microsoft SQL Server", "InstalledInstances").sValue
#Find SQL Instance, only one instance per server, for now sorry.
foreach ($regkey in $regkeys) {
if ($regkey -like "MSSQL*" -and $regkey -like "*.*") {
$instance = $regkey
}
}
#Try to find a connection either through listener or direct to server, or by instance name
write-host "Connecting to SQL $server..."
[reflection.assembly]::LoadWithPartialName("Microsoft.SqlServer.Smo") | Out-Null
#Via listenername instance and port
if ($listenerName -notlike $NULL) { $srv = New-Object ('Microsoft.SqlServer.Management.Smo.Server') "$listenerName\$instance,$SQLPort" }
else {
#instance only
$srv = New-Object ('Microsoft.SqlServer.Management.Smo.Server') "$server\$instance"
if ($srv.DatabaseEngineEdition -notlike "*$SQLEdition*") {
#instance and port
$srv = New-Object ('Microsoft.SqlServer.Management.Smo.Server') "$server\$instance,$SQLPort"
}
}
#Get all SQL Login accounts
foreach ($login in $srv.logins) {
$loginname = $login.name
clear-variable userrole -ErrorAction SilentlyContinue
foreach ($role in $Login.ListMembers()) {
$role
$role = $role | out-string
$userrole += $role + ", "
}
$userrole = $userrole.replace("`n", "")
$userrole = $userrole + "public"
$userrole
if ($login.name -notlike "*dbo*" -and $login.name -notlike "sys"`
-and $login.name -notlike "guest" -and $login.name -notlike "*##*"`
-and $login.name -notlike "*MS_*" -and $login.name -notlike "*_SCHEMA*") {
#Create an object and write properties about the account
$row = New-Object PSObject
$row | Add-Member -MemberType NoteProperty -Name "Database" -Value "Server Login"
$row | Add-Member -MemberType NoteProperty -Name "Login" -Value $login.name
$row | Add-Member -MemberType NoteProperty -Name "Created" -Value $Login.CreateDate
$row | Add-Member -MemberType NoteProperty -Name "Modified" -Value $Login.DateLastModified
$row | Add-Member -MemberType NoteProperty -Name "LoginType" -Value $Login.LoginType
$row | Add-Member -MemberType NoteProperty -Name "Service Account" -Value $ServiceAccount
$row | Add-Member -MemberType NoteProperty -Name "Roles" -Value $userrole
$row | Add-Member -MemberType NoteProperty -Name "Disabled" -Value $login.isdisabled
$sql_perm_data += $row
#Turn properties into variables for writing to SQL
$Loginname = $Login.name
$LoginCreateDate = $Login.CreateDate
$LoginDateLastModified = $Login.DateLastModified
$LoginLoginType = $Login.LoginType
$Loginisdisabled = $Login.isdisabled
$Databasename = "Server Login"
if ($srv.DatabaseEngineEdition -like "*Enterprise*") { } else { $AGNAME = "No SQL Connection" }
#Write SQL Login Information to a SQL Row
$query = "
INSERT into $storeTABLE (IP,CNAME,DB,DOMAIN,LOGIN,CREATED,MODIFIED,LOGINTYPE,SERVICEACCOUNT,ROLES,DISABLED,DATE,MONTH,DAY,YEAR,AGNAME,LISNAME,CLUNAME) VALUES ('$IP','$Server','$Databasename','$DOMAIN','$LoginName','$LoginCreateDate','$LoginDateLastModified','$LoginLoginType','$ServiceAccount','$userrole','$loginisdisabled','$date','$Month','$Day','$Year','$agname','$listenername','$clustername')
"
Invoke-Sqlcmd -ServerInstance $storeSQLServer -Database $storeSQLdatabase-Query $query -MaxCharLength 3000 -Verbose
}
}
#Begin getting security information for each database
foreach ($database in $srv.Databases) {
$users = $database.Users
foreach ($user in $users | where-object { $_.HasDBAccess -like "True" }) {
Clear-Variable userrole -ErrorAction SilentlyContinue
Write-Output "`n Processing $server , $database , $user "
foreach ($role in $Database.Roles) {
$role = $role.name | out-string
$userrole += $role + ", "
}
$userrole = $userrole.replace("`n", "")
$userrole = $userrole + "@"
$userrole = $userrole.replace(", @", "")
if ($user.name -notlike "sys"`
-and $user.name -notlike "guest" -and $user.name -notlike "*##*"`
-and $user.name -notlike "*MS_*" -and $user.name -notlike "*_SCHEMA*") {
if ($user.name -like "*ss01*")
{ $ServiceAccount = "True" } else { $ServiceAccount = "False" }
$row = New-Object PSObject
$row | Add-Member -MemberType NoteProperty -Name "Database" -Value $Database.name
$row | Add-Member -MemberType NoteProperty -Name "Login" -Value $user.name
$row | Add-Member -MemberType NoteProperty -Name "Created" -Value $user.CreateDate
$row | Add-Member -MemberType NoteProperty -Name "Modified" -Value $user.DateLastModified
$row | Add-Member -MemberType NoteProperty -Name "LoginType" -Value $user.LoginType
$row | Add-Member -MemberType NoteProperty -Name "Service Account" -Value $ServiceAccount
$row | Add-Member -MemberType NoteProperty -Name "Roles" -Value $userrole
$row | Add-Member -MemberType NoteProperty -Name "Disabled" -Value $user.isdisabled
$sql_perm_data += $row
$userName = $user.Name
$userCreateDate = $user.CreateDate
$userDateLastModified = $user.DateLastModified
$userLoginType = $user.LoginType
$userisdisabled = $user.isdisabled
$Databasename = $Database.name
write-host "has db access: " $user.HasDBAccess
if ($srv.DatabaseEngineEdition -like "*$SQLEdition*") { } else { $AGNAME = "No SQL Connection" }
$query = "
INSERT into $storeTable (IP,CNAME,DB,DOMAIN,LOGIN,CREATED,MODIFIED,LOGINTYPE,SERVICEACCOUNT,ROLES,DISABLED,DATE,MONTH,DAY,YEAR,AGNAME,LISNAME,CLUNAME) VALUES ('$IP','$Server','$Databasename','$DOMAIN','$UserName','$UserCreateDate','$UserDateLastModified','$UserLoginType','$ServiceAccount','$userrole','$userisdisabled','$date','$Month','$Day','$Year','$agname','$listenername','$clustername')
"
Invoke-Sqlcmd -ServerInstance $storeSQLServer -Database $storeSQLdatabase-Query $query -MaxCharLength 3000 -Verbose
}
}
}
}
}
